You can ONLY drink BUD at the Bud Rising Festival in Dublin

category international | rights, freedoms and repression | news report author Thursday June 02, 2005 02:02author by Bud decending - Campaign for tasty beer, the way it used to be, the way it should beauthor email guinness at japaneseplace dot jp Report this post to the editors

Is Bud such a crap beer that they have resorted to forcing people to drink it?

i bought a ticket to see a band in The Village this evening. But when I went to the bar I discovered red socks over all the taps for the draught beer.

Red Budwiser socks! covering the Erdinger and other beers!!

All the fridges were full of Budwizer bottles. And then the true nature of the nightmare became apparent.

YOU CAN ONLY DRINK BUD AT THE CONCERTS AT THIS BUD FESTIVAL!!!

But nowhere on all the printed material about this festival does it warn innocent punters out for a good night that this is the case.

There were other people standing at the bar with jaws a droppin' - wondering what the hell they could do.

Is Bud so bad that they have to force us to drink it by making nothing else available???

And in forcing people to drink their beer are they admitting something about it?

It was a corporate takeover at the bar without any warning!

Are corporate take overs and coercion cool and rock and roll now??
So I went down to the cash desk and complained and got my money back and left.

I went up to Redmonds in Ranelagh and got some really tasty beers and the guy behind the desk confirmed that Bud are in real trouble and the beer just isnt selling. Its even being outsold by Corrs Light - how bad is that?
